Orange Blueberry Multigrain Loaf. Orange Juice, Blueberry Compote, and Multigrain Cereal. Vegan Recipe.
Recipe Snapshot
- Prep time: 35 minutes
- Cook time: 55 minutes
- Total time: 90 minutes
- Yield: 10 servings
- Category: Bread
- Cuisine: American, Vegan
Ingredients
- 2 cups whole wheat flour
- 2 cups bread flour
- 1/2 cup multigrain cereal
- 2 teaspoon raw sugar
- 1.5 teaspoons active yeast
- 2/3 cup of water
- 1/2 cup blueberry compote
- 1/2 cup orange juice
- 1 tablespoon vegan butter
- 1 flax egg
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
Method
- Boil the water and add cereal to it. Cook for 5 minutes then cool to a warm 110. Add the yeast and mix well. Let stand for 10 minutes or until frothy.
- In the mixer bowl add the flours, salt and mix well
- Add in the yeast mixture, softened butter, egg, blueberry compote and half of the orange juice.
- Knead the dough for 8-10 minutes, scraping sides every 2-3 minutes. add more flour or orange juice in little quantities if needed.
- Place dough in a covered container in a warm place for 1.5-2 hours. Spritz the top of dough with some oil spray.
- Punch it lightly and shape into a loaf by pulling on all sides, or by rolling it out into a rectangle and rolling the rectangle from one side and tucking the edges under.
- Place loaf in greased bread pan. Spritz the top with a little oil spray and cover with damp towel.
- Place it in a warm place or warm oven for about an hour.
- Remove towel, spritz top with some water and bake at 375 degrees F for 40-45 minutes.
- Remove bread from pan and let cool for atleast an hour.
- I usually refrigerate it for another hour before slicing. The breads are usually quite fluffy and soft and refrigeration makes them a bit firm for nice and clean slices!
